Description
The MTECH Systems 8200-CHS Ceilometer is a compact instrument designed for fixed and tactical installations where accurate and reliable cloud height information is required. The measurement is based on the LIDAR principle.
The light emitting component is a low power diode laser with the output power limited to an eye-safe level whilst advanced optics and signal processing techniques extend the range from near ground level to over 26000 ft.
Measurement Technique
The 8200-CHS uses a coaxial single lens design providing very low interference and enhanced near field performance. The well defined laser pulse shape and real time digitizing techniques utilise the latest high speed, high dynamic range scan converter. This, combined with interlaced scan techniques gives excellent resolution and accuracy. The 8200-CHS has a powerful 40 MIPS RISC microprocessor performing advanced signal processing algorithms to detect multiple cloud bases and sky condition.
Environmental Performance
The 8200-CHS performs in all environmental conditions from desert to the wet equatorial tropics. The heated windows and the double skinned design with internal heating and cooling maintain the internal systems at stable
temperature and eliminate internal condensation under all conditions. The internal optical components are protected from direct solar radiation by optical solar filters as standard. All electrical connections to the unit are surge protected. During rain and snow or in the absence of a detectable cloud base the vertical
visibility is reported.
Data Presentation
The Data port provides standard data formats via Ethernet, RS232, and RS422 standards. Cloud layer detection algorithms are built in to the instrument firmware and the 8200-CHS is supplied with Graphical Cloud analysis software for a workstation. Where required, the signal return profile can be obtained for each scan. The
internal RS-232C and Ethernet interfaces support local and remote control, test and data acquisition. Wireless radio, microwave, conventional or DSL modem options can also be used.
Maintenance
The 8200-CHS has an Ethernet maintenance port and windows based configuration software for ease of
setup either locally or remotely. Sloping windows fitted with a heater minimise build-up of dust and debris
(including condensation and ice), and the slope maximises the cleansing effect of rainfall. A built-in test
system indicates failures in the event of a malfunction. A key feature for field maintenance is the small
number of types of spare modules required compared with other designs. The key optical alignment is
inherent to the instrument, so the line replaceable modules can easily be replaced by spare parts without
adjustments or re-calibration.
